Abu Dawud Book 2, Hadith Number 1332.

Chapter : On the number of rakahs of the prayer at night.

Narated By N/A : This tradition has also been transmitted bu Ibn Shihab through a different chain of narrators to the same effect. This version adds: He would observe witr with a single rak’ah and make a prostration about as long as one of you would take to recite fifty verses before raising his head. When the mu’adhdhdin finished his call for the dawn prayer and the dawn became clear to him… Then the narrator transmitted the rest of the tradition to the same effect.
